Dave most of the ebay ones are illegal anyway so i wouldn't buy them. Take your documents to allparts of halfords if you want legal because all plates have to be BS AU 145d type approved and carry the makers name and postcode. Any that aren't risk you getting the same £30 fine as having glaringly illegal plates (and you can get one fine for each plate and have your plates seized) so IMO either decide your gonna take the risk and get something you like or be totally legal.

It wont be long before they really start cracking down on it. With the advent of ANPR on every street corner and every police car vehicles on false plates are becoming more common and people with plates that don't conform will start getting fined because it will put the illegal plate makers out of business and thus make it harder for the "real" criminals.
